Rhinotropis cornuta
Synonym: Polygala cornuta.
English: Sierra milkwort.
Habitat: mountain ranges; chaparral, forest.
region: California and northern Baja California,
Botany
Rhizomatous perennial herb or shrub; 2 meters in maximum height, spreading or growing erect. Leaves: linear, lance-shaped, or narrowly oval; 6.5 centimeters long, and widely spaced along the branches.
Inflorescence: short array of flowers.
Flowers: greenish or yellowish white to pink; with two winglike lateral sepals, and the keeled central petal is tipped with a short beak.
Fruit: brownish flattened capsule.
